Transaction f913923b23f91ad18e6ab888647abb94a58767a2acbf8988c5b6b78545873560
1 Input
2 Outputs
- f913923b23f91ad18e6ab888647abb94a58767a2acbf8988c5b6b78545873560:0
- f913923b23f91ad18e6ab888647abb94a58767a2acbf8988c5b6b78545873560:1
value 50718
address 2N9mAPMD823Zt5LJgGD31MjAbeN9LpRP6xw
value 1057610
address 2MzH33r6htvAhFSVGZnXVhU42SznqtATi5C